Hamiduddin farahi 18 november 1863 11 november 1930 was an indian islamic scholar known for his work on the concept of nazm, or coherence, in the quran he was instrumental in producing scholarly work on the theory that the verses of the quran are interconnected in such a way that each surah, or chapter, of the quran forms a coherent structure, having its own central theme, which he. Amin ahsan islahi 1904 15 december 1997 was a pakistani muslim scholar, famous for his urdu exegeses of quran, tadabburiquran pondering on the quran an exegesis that he based on hamiduddin farahis 1863 1930 idea of thematic and structural coherence in the quran. Farahi was born in phreha hence the name farahi, a village in the district of azamgarh uttar pradesh, india.
